Malicious programs that can hack WhatsApp to allow unauthorized access to messages could cost up to $20 millionaccording to this TechCrunch. Documents obtained by the website show how the price of this type of malware has increased in recent years.

According to the report published on Thursday (5), the amount equivalent to R$ 103 million at current prices was offered by a Russian company last week. Was interested in purchasing “zero-day hacks”Exploiting flaws unknown to the software developer.

The malware will be provided by the company to a group of customers consisting of “private and government organizations” based in Russia and Remotely compromise Android phones and iPhones. This amount is well above the amount collected in 2021.

Also according to the post, the malware will exploit zero-day flaw in WhatsApp two years ago it cost between US$1.7 million and US$8 million (R$8.78 million to R$41.3 million).. The low amount indicates a zero-click attack targeting Messenger on Android, which does not require any user action to compromise the program.

Why has hacking WhatsApp become so expensive?

constants Meta messaging app updatesThese features, which strengthen the security of the service, are cited as one of the reasons for the increase in hacking costs. In addition, tools launched by operating systems, such as the iOS lock mode, make it difficult for the platform to be invaded and data stolen.

The site mentions Russia’s invasion of Ukraine as another reason for the price increase. Many tech experts He refused to work with Vladimir Putin’s government As the fighting continues, they change their minds, demanding the payment of bonuses, but the increase is also taking place outside Russian territory.

Attacks targeting WhatsApp are mostly targeted Employees of government agencies, such as intelligence agencies and regulatory agencies, According to the report. By spying on the program, attackers can get what they need from messages sent through the application and avoid compromising the entire mobile phone.

At least Three flaws that could be exploited in hacks mentioned in the documents were fixed by messenger between 2020 and 2021.. Meta did not comment on the matter.
